5 out of 5 stars Delicious and Easy--My Kind of Cookbook   June 19, 2008
 1 out of 1 found this review helpful

This has probably been the best cookbook purchase I've ever made. All of the recipes that I have tried (about a good 1/3 of the book already) have turned out wonderfully and best of all I--a novice cook--have been able to actually make them. And lest you think that the recipes are geared only to the amateur, my fiance, who is quite the foodie, also turns to this cookbook first when we are trying to figure out what to make for the week. Especially recommended are the home-made breakfast bars (totally yummy, though we add dark chocolate chips), roast chicken, stuffed peppers. Highly recommended!
